The present invention relates to augmented reality applications and more particularly to a method of simulating a virtual out-of-box experience of a package product.
Consumers have all found themselves inside a retail store or browsing a shopping website contemplating a large purchase. They pick up the box and carefully examine the product image or zoom in on images in the website storefront, in the case of an online retailer, all the while wishing they could take the product out of the box and further inspect it. Better yet, they wish they could even try it out to a certain extent in an attempt to lower their risk of being dissatisfied. However, providing live demonstration products is expensive. Additionally, online retailers desire to minimize the chance of costly returns, which result in unnecessary shipping charges and damaged packaging and products. Therefore, there is a need in the industry for a method for a consumer to more closely inspect and interact with a product prior to purchasing that foregoes the need for costly demonstration models in bricks and mortar retail and minimizes returns for online retailers.
The exemplary embodiment seeks to solve the problem of the prior art by providing an application that a consumer can download on an electronic device, such as smartphone which simulates a virtual out-of-box experience of a packaged product. The packaging of the product has a computer-readable code which is scanned with a camera on the electronic device. A product demonstration is retrieved for the product from the internet. The packaging of the product is recognized by the application and an image of a virtual representation of the product is overlaid on an image of the packaging to make a combined image. The combined image is displayed to the user on the display of the electronic device wherein the combined image simulates X-Ray vision into the packaging revealing the product therein. The method further updates the combined image as the user manipulates the product in front of the camera, revealing different views of the product. The virtual product may further be displayed outside the packaging for closer inspection. The user may demonstrate features of the virtual product to see it function.
More specifically, the exemplary method provides a virtual out-of-box experience for the user through an application that recognizes the product packaging, by any one of the images on the six sides of the product packaging. Images of the product packaging have been pre-profiled within the application. When any side of the product packaging is recognized in the camera's field of view by the application, the user's perspective to the image on the product packaging is determined by the application based on the image's distortion (e.g., skew, tilt, barrel, and/or pincushion) and size of the image when compared to the pre-profiled image. The application renders a three-dimensional model of the product directly on, or relative to, the surface of the box, providing an augmented reality. When any side of the product packaging is detected, the virtual product is shown lying beneath the surface so that it appears that the user sees through the product packaging. The virtual product may also be displayed on the outside of the packaging, such as on top of the packaging or adjacent to any side of the packaging, thus showing the product out of the box. The packaging becomes a reference point for manipulating the virtual product. Moving, turning, rotating the packaging, moves, rotates and turns the virtual product.

The method provides an immersive out-of-box experience using augmented reality. By using an electronic device equipped with a camera and display, such as a Smartphone or tablet (or could be a wearable device such as glasses that has the capability) the user is able to see inside the product packaging, virtually take the product out of the box, view the product from all angles (including from the inside), and power up the product and interact with it in a natural way. If the product has buttons, the user can “virtually” press them and see the actual product response. If the product has a display, the user can see the actual screens shown on the product. If the product has sound, the audio may be played to the users and if it is voice activated the user can speak with the product and issue voice commands. These features provide the user the ability to completely interact with the product without ever even taking it out of the box.
